On Mon, 30 Nov 2015, Mathias Nyman wrote: > usb2 ports need to signal resume for 20ms before moving to U0 state. > Both device and host can initiate resume. > > On host initated resume port is set to resume state, sleep 20ms, > and finally set port to U0 state. That's an odd approach. The assumption in usbcore is that the HCD will not sleep here. > On device initated resume a port status interrupt with a port in resume > state in issued. The interrupt handler tags a resume_done[port] > timestamp with current time + 20ms, and kick roothub timer. > Root hub timer requests for port status, finds the port in resume state, > checks if resume_done[port] timestamp passed, and set port to U0 state. ehci-hcd does the same thing, except that it also uses this resume_done timestamp with host-initiated resumes. > There are a few issues with this approach, > 1. A host initated resume will also generate a resume event, the event > handler will find the port in resume state, believe it's a device > initated and act accordingly. > > 2. A port status request might cut the 20ms resume signalling short if a > get_port_status request is handled during the 20ms host resume. > The port will be found in resume state. The timestamp is not set leading > to time_after_eq(jiffoes, timestamp) returning true, as timestamp = 0. > get_port_status will proceed with moving the port to U0. > > 3. If an error, or anything else happends to the port during device > initated 20ms resume signalling it will leave all device resume > parameters hanging uncleared preventing further resume. > > Fix this by using the existing resuming_ports bitfield to indicate if > resume signalling timing is taken care of. > Also check if the resume_done[port] is set before using it in time > comparison. Also clear out any resume signalling related variables if port > is not in U0 or Resume state. Wouldn't it be better to change the host-initiated resume mechanism to be consisten with device-initiated resumes? Or would that be too big a change for the time being? Or would that be too big a > change for the time being? > > Alan Stern > Yes, changing host initiated resume code would make sense. Hence the comment in the testpatch: /* Host initated resume doesn't time the resume * signalling using resume_done[]. * It manually sets RESUME state, sleeps 20ms * and sets U0 state. This should probably be * changed, but not right now, do nothing */ I was focusing more on clearing the stale resume related variables and didn't want to dig into the history of host initiated resume code at that moment. If ehci-hcd is using the timestamp + kick roothub approach for host resume, then I don't see why xhci can't do the same. -Mathias -- To unsubscribe from this list: send the line "unsubscribe linux-kernel" in the body of a message to majordomo@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html Please read the FAQ at http://www.tux.org/lkml/
